While out riding my trike late this afternoon, I saw 2 female Cooper's Hawks: one was an adult, and one was an immature one. They were about one mile apart, so they may not be related? Yesterday, I saw an adult Bald Eagle cruising around the eastern most storm water retention pond on Magnolia St. First time that I have seen one in that area since last February. Today, I saw an Osprey perched on a street light near the western most storm water retention pond on Magnolia St. And, while visiting friends in the Clear Lake area today, I saw an immature female Cooper's Hawk up close as it flew from a tree along Pineloch and flew along side the car for about one block. She looked like she had a full crop. Mira M.
